把你的 GIMP 变成 PhotoShop
创始人
2024-03-02 05:11:35
0

GIMP( GNU 图像处理程序 GNU Image Manipulation Program )是一个一流的开源自由的图像处理程序。加州大学伯克利分校的 Peter Mattis 和 Spencer Kimball 早在 1995 年的时候开始了该程序的开发。到了 1997 年,该程序成为了 GNU 项目 官方组成部分,并正式更名为 GIMP。时至今日,GIMP 已经成为了最好的图像编辑器之一,并有经常有 “GIMP vs Photoshop” 之争。

GIMP 不仅仅有 Linux 版本,在 Windows 和 macOS 平台上,也一直有大量专业用户。它被很多人认为是 Photoshop 的最佳替代品之一。不过,由于 GIMP 采用了和 PhotoShop 不同的用户界面和交互逻辑,因此那些从 Photoshop 迁移过来的用户需要一段时间的适应。

Photo GIMP 补丁

现在,有人开发了一个新的补丁,可以将你的 GIMP “打扮” 得像 Photoshop 一样。这个补丁就是 PhotoGIMP,它所做的就是调整 GIMP,使其模仿 Photoshop 的界面,同时还增加了一堆额外的功能。

该补丁是针对 GIMP 2.10 的,主要提供的特性有:

  • 对工具箱进行组织,以模仿 Adobe Photoshop
  • 默认安装数百种新字体
  • 默认安装新的 Python 滤镜,如 heal selection
  • 新的启动闪屏
  • 新的默认设置,以最大化画布空间
  • 按照 Adobe 文档为 Photoshop 上的相似功能设置快捷键
  • 自定义的 .desktop 文件添加了新的图标和名称
  • 新的默认语言是英语(如果你想的话,仍然可以在设置中更改)

安装该补丁后,GIMP 的外观看起来如下:

如何安装

这里是以 flatpak 做示例介绍的,但这个补丁其实“只是文件”而已,所以,你可以在以任何打包方式安装的 GIMP 上使用(.deb、.rpm、Snap、AppImage、Windows、macOS),只需检查每个系统/包中 GIMP 文件的本地化。

准备 Flatpak 环境

首先,你需要使用 Flatpak 在系统上安装最新的 GIMP。

通过 AppCenter/Package Manager 或终端安装 GIMP Flatpak:

flatpak install flathub org.gimp.GIMP

安装此补丁

发布页面的 .zip 文件中,你会发现三个隐藏的文件夹(在 Linux 上,使用名字前的 . 来隐藏文件)。所有这些文件夹都必须解压到你的 /home/$USER 文件夹中,如果你在之前的安装中已经有了相同的文件,那么就会覆盖所有内容。

该文件有以下目录。

  • .icons(这里有一个新的 PhotoGIMP 图标)
  • .local(其中包含个性化的 .desktop 文件)
  • .var (其中包含 GIMP 2.10+ 的 flatpak 补丁定制)

如果你只是想要自定义 PhotoGIMP,而不改变原来的 GIMP 图标和名称,只需解压 .var 文件夹到你的主目录。

想在 Windows、macOS 或 Ubuntu(Snap)上使用?

由于这个补丁只是文件,你唯一需要做的就是将软件仓库中的 /.var/app/org.gimp.GIMP/config/GIMP/2.10 中的所有文件复制到每个特定系统的 GIMP 文件夹中,覆盖现有的文件。

  • Windows:C:/Users/YOUR_USER/AppData/Roaming/GIMP/2.10
  • macOS:/Users/Library/Application Support/GIMP/2.10/
  • Ubuntu(Snap):/home/$USER/snap/gimp/47/.config/GIMP/2.10/
  • 常规 Linux 安装(.deb、.rpm):/home/$USER/.config/GIMP/2.10/

GIMP 在 macOS 上的发布时间有点延迟,这样一来,这个补丁仍然可以工作,特别是在快捷键方面,但有些东西,比如工具箱的组织,至少要等到 macOS 版本达到 2.10.20 版本。

新的图标只有通过 Linux 环境下的补丁提取才能使用,但你可以在你的系统上手动设置它。

总结

好了,你是不是从 PhotoShop 转移过来的 GIMP 用户,你有没有试过这个补丁?你觉得这个补丁有用吗?欢迎留言。

相关内容

开源图像编辑器 GIMP ...
IT之家 6 月 24 日消息,科技媒体 9to5Linux 昨日...
2025-06-24 13:12:59
不知道名称的情况下,使用J...
要使用JavaScript更改Photoshop中的第一层的名称,...
2025-01-12 02:31:17
不删除裁剪像素的裁剪?- ...
要实现“不删除裁剪像素的裁剪”功能,你可以使用Photoshop ...
2024-12-28 02:31:38
遍历嵌套的GIMP分组以检...
以下是一个示例代码,用于遍历嵌套的GIMP分组以检索图层数组:fr...
2024-12-04 01:31:14
Backtrackingi...
回溯算法是一种非常重要的算法,其应用广泛。下面我们来介绍如何在C语...
2024-11-20 06:01:18
Android数据绑定:无...
在Android数据绑定中,如果在生成的数据绑定文件中找不到......
2024-10-10 17:01:01

热门资讯

Helix:高级 Linux ... 说到 基于终端的文本编辑器,通常 Vim、Emacs 和 Nano 受到了关注。这并不意味着没有其他...
《Apex 英雄》正式可在 S... 《Apex 英雄》现已通过 Steam Deck 验证,这使其成为支持 Linux 的顶级多人游戏之...
使用 KRAWL 扫描 Kub... 用 KRAWL 脚本来识别 Kubernetes Pod 和容器中的错误。当你使用 Kubernet...
JStock:Linux 上不... 如果你在股票市场做投资,那么你可能非常清楚投资组合管理计划有多重要。管理投资组合的目标是依据你能承受...
从 Yum 更新中排除特定/某... 作为系统更新的一部分,你也许需要在基于 Red Hat 系统中由于应用依赖排除一些软件包。如果是,如...
如何在 Github 上创建一... 学习如何复刻一个仓库,进行更改,并要求维护人员审查并合并它。你知道如何使用 git 了,你有一个 G...
Epic 游戏商店现在可在 S... 现在可以在 Steam Deck 上运行 Epic 游戏商店了,几乎无懈可击! 但是,它是非官方的。...
通过 SaltStack 管理... 我在搜索Puppet的替代品时,偶然间碰到了Salt。我喜欢puppet,但是我又爱上Salt了:)...
如何检查你的 Linux 系统... 不知道在使用哪个初始化系统?以下是方法。每个主流 Linux 发行版(包括 Ubuntu、Fedor...
如何理解Apache 2.0许... 提要:Apache 2.0许可证中的专利许可条款使得开源代码可以安全使用,但它经常被误解。Apach...